Web4. Dimensional stability. Because of wet shrinkage, rayon apparel fabrics can cause garment dimensional changes after laundering. Control of fabric dimensional stability is critical to ensure the production of high-quality garments. A maximum shrinkage should be defined in the fabric material specifications.
